Hi all. Can anyone help identify the place and maker of this large soup ladle which I think is German? The town mark looks like a winged griffin and the maker's mark is FTC. There is another mark, FW in script and an assay scrape. There is also an engraved inscription with date 1795. The ladle is 37cm long and weighs 220 grams. Many thanks. John

The soup ladle was produced by Friedrich T. Crowecke in Stargard in Pomerania (now Poland)
